Output 540478efe926da07755ee50e864f6f7ef287c0f72b8e5a98dd8a449e12eba7d0:0

value
17593465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39f6bb32ede932f5d9bdca9efc0b07add59efb9d OP_EQUAL
address
MDBeKYyGQcQBiBTnmBeByQEdKR6aqmWJMZ
transaction
540478efe926da07755ee50e864f6f7ef287c0f72b8e5a98dd8a449e12eba7d0
spent
true